Blackletter Abpe 10 is a regular weight, very narrow, medium contrast, upright, short x-height font.

A very condensed blackletter with tall, upright proportions and a tight rhythm. Strokes show a pen-drawn, slightly irregular edge with small notches and tapering terminals that create a scratched, worn texture. Counters are narrow and often pinched, and many letters lean on straight vertical stems with occasional sharp, wedge-like joins and broken-looking curves. Overall spacing feels compact, while widths vary by glyph, giving words a lively, hand-cut cadence rather than a strictly modular pattern.
Best suited for short display settings where atmosphere is the priority: posters, title cards, band/album artwork, game or film graphics, and themed packaging. It can work for pull quotes or headings, but longer text will benefit from generous size and tracking to avoid crowding in the narrow counters.
The face conveys a gothic, medieval mood with an ominous, occult-leaning tone. Its jagged detailing and compressed verticality read as archaic and dramatic, suggesting ritual text, dungeon signage, or grim story titles rather than everyday neutrality.
The design appears intended to evoke hand-rendered blackletter with a distressed, blade-cut finish—prioritizing texture, vertical drama, and historical flavor over smooth regularity. The condensed build helps it fit emphatic headlines while retaining an ornate, medieval character.
Uppercase forms are tall and decorative, with several letters featuring inner cuts and uneven contours that add visual grit. The lowercase maintains a restrained x-height with prominent ascenders and compact bowls; at small sizes the dense interiors can darken quickly. Numerals share the same sharp, calligraphic construction, with pointed turns and narrow apertures that keep the set visually consistent.
